❶ Linux查看端口状态及关闭端口方法
Linux查看端口状态及关闭端口的方法如下:
查看端口状态:1. 使用netstat命令: 通过~$ netstat anp命令可以查看哪些端口被打开。加参数n会将应用程序转为端口显示,即数字格式的地址,方便对应程序与端口号。
使用lsof命令:
查看/etc/services文件:
使用nmap命令:
关闭端口:1. 使用iptables工具禁用端口: 通过~$ sudo iptables A INPUT p tcp dport $PORT j DROP和~$ sudo iptables A OUTPUT p tcp dport $PORT j DROP命令可以禁用特定端口。
注意:关闭端口实际上是通过关闭对应的进程来实现的,或者通过防火墙规则来禁用特定端口的通信。直接“关闭端口”而不关闭进程在Linux中并不常见,通常是通过禁用端口来达到类似的效果。